Scrapbooking has gone a long way. What was once a simple hobby has today turned into a multi-bilion dollar business. With the increase of global demand to preserve mmories in the most beautiful and unique way, scrapbooking has today become one of the most popular and succesfull businesses, the majority of which are home-based small enterprises. Statistics estimate that the scrapbooking business in the United States--on of the fastest growing homes industries in the country--is now generating an annual income of US$2.25 billion. And the number will most likely increase every year.
The market for scrapbook is growing exponentially. Weddings, the birth of a child, and travelling are three of the most popular events that end up in scrapbooks--and people are willing to pay a hefty sum to have professional scrapbook artists do it for them. With around 2.3 million weddings in the US alone, there's already a huge market in the States for scrapbook business.
